Jackson, Tenn., Fighting To Keep Its EAS Subsidies

The Jackson-Madison County Airport Authority is urging the U.S. Transportation Dept. to rescind a tentative order ending Essential Air Service subsidies for McKellar-Sipes Regional Airport, disputing DOT findings that the $200-per-passenger subsidy cap continued to be exceeded after several DOT...
